Job Overview As a Lush Spa Receptionist, you are the face of the spa, creating a warm and welcoming atmosphere for every guest. You'll be responsible for providing outstanding customer service, managing bookings, and supporting the spa team in delivering an unforgettable experience. You'll also play the role of hosting and building relationships with customers and promoting the spa within the local community. Receptionists play an integral role in keeping the spa running smoothly behind the scenes. Requiring individuals to be organised and able to follow processes and procedures. You will need to be proactive in navigating the digital landscape, staying up to date with the latest systems, cross checking sales data is accounted for correctly. Each day spa takings will need to be shared and communicated with management to enable the cashing up process to be correct.
